Connectivity File transfer Use a computer equipped with Bluetooth to view and transfer files in the file manager. Use drag-and-drop functionality to: • Transfer files between phone and computer. • Move and organize files. • Delete files from the phone. Infrared port Use the infrared port as a transfer method with compatible devices. You can, for example, synchronize calendar items % 57 Synchronizing, and send items such as pictures. When connecting to a computer, refer to its user documentation. Make sure that computer infrared speed is set to 115200 bps. To turn the infrared port on } Settings } the Connectivity tab } Infrared port } On or } 10 minutes to turn on for 10 minutes. To connect two devices 1 Turn on infrared in both devices. 2 Make sure the infrared port on your phone is facing the infrared port on the other device with a maximum distance of 20 cm. To send an item using the infrared port (example: a contact) 1 Make sure that infrared in both devices is on. } Contacts and select a contact. 2 } More } Send contact } Via infrared. Transferring files using the USB cable Your phone comes with a USB cable and when you connect your phone to a computer using the USB cable, the phone memory will appear as a drive on the computer. Only use the USB cable included with the phone and connect it directly to your computer. Use computer drag-and-drop functionality to: • Transfer files between phone and computer. • Move and organize files. • Delete files from the phone.
